Pattern film, method for manufacturing pattern film, and transmittance variable device comprising same

1. A pattern film, comprising:
a base layer; and
a spacer pattern formed on the base layer,
wherein the spacer pattern comprises a partition wall spacer and a ball spacer,
wherein the partition wall spacer comprises a plurality of spacer dots and a spacer line connecting the spacer dots,
wherein the ball spacer is one of embedded in, partially embedded in, or in contact with the partition wall spacer,
wherein, when any 3 or more spacer dots are selected among the plurality of spacer dots, the spacer line forms a closed figure having the selected spacer dots at the vertices thereof, wherein the selected spacer dots are not present inside the closed figure,
wherein a length of at least one side of the closed figure is different from the lengths of the remaining sides,
wherein each spacer dot in the plurality has irregularity of 50% or greater,
wherein a rectangular 200×200 pixel area is set based on an area of the pattern film through which light passes from an LED light source, and
wherein, using a lower left end corner of the rectangular 200×200 pixel area as x axis, y axis (0,0), the rectangular 200×200 pixel area of (0,0) to (200,200) satisfies the following Equation 3:
2≤D1−D2(%)≤10  [Equation 3]
in Equation 3, D1 is a diffraction ratio when the spacer dot of the pattern film has irregularity of 0%; D2 is a diffraction ratio when the spacer dot of the pattern film has irregularity of 70%; and each diffraction ratio satisfies the following Equation 4:
[1−Sc/S]×100(%)  [Equation 4]
in Equation 4, S is a total amount of light in the rectangular 200×200 pixel area of (0,0) to (200,200); and Sc is an amount of pixel light in an area having pixels employing (100,100) as an origin and having a radius of 50 in the rectangular 200×200 pixel area of (0,0) to (200,200).
